Solutions for Inventory Control.

Drone-Based Pasture Audits

Drone-Based Pasture Audits

We build AI and computer vision that program drone flights to scan thousands of acres, stitch the footage, and accurately count every animal, automatically separating cattle from rocks, brush, and shadows.

Gate & Chute Counting

Gate & Chute Counting

For shipping/receiving, mount a camera above the loading ramp. The system counts animals as they load onto the truck, providing a video-verified digital receipt to prove exactly what was shipped.

Feedlot Pen Verification

Feedlot Pen Verification

For daily ops, cameras mounted on feed trucks or pen riders' helmets scan the bunk line. The AI compares the visual count to your records, flagging "Ghost Cattle" (dead or missing) instantly.

How We Engineer 99.9% Accuracy?

Step 1_ Multi-Altitude Detection

Step 1: Multi-Altitude Detection

Cows look different from 10ft (Gate) vs 100ft (Drone). We train models on multiple datasets to recognize the dorsal (top-down) view of the animal regardless of height.

Step 2_ Cluster Segmentation

Step 2: Cluster Segmentation

When cows bunch together, they look like one big blob. We use Instance Segmentation (Mask R-CNN) to draw outlines around individual animals, separating a "cluster of 5" into five distinct counts.

Step 3_ Motion Tracking (DeepSORT)

Step 3: Motion Tracking (DeepSORT)

For gate counting, we don't just count frames. We track the unique ID of the cow as it moves across the screen. If a cow walks back and forth, the logic corrects the count (-1 / +1) to prevent duplicates.

Step 4_ Edge Deployment

Step 4: Edge Deployment

No internet in the pasture? No problem. We deploy the counting model on the drone controller or a ruggedized tablet, giving you the final number before you even leave the field.
